
LETTERS: Poor treatment for pensioners
IT'S official: Australian pensioners are among the shabbiest treated in the developed world.
A new OECD report says we have the second-lowest age pension out of 33 developed nations and the discrepancy between the average wage and the pension is among the highest.
It seems our highly-paid politicians have the answer; cut part-pensions and grab another pay rise for themselves and public servants.
The next federal election will be a shock for Liberals and Labor.
The Libs managed to bash part-pensioners with the help of Labor's mates, the Greens (thanks to Sarah Hanson-Young, who overspent her entitlements by more than $8000 last year).
Pensioners should also thank Julie Bishop for wasting $30,000 on a charter flight:
That's nearly a year's pension for a couple and $8000 more than a year's pension for a single.
MARY DAVIES, Grandchester
